Course Description

The program begins with a review of the CAHRS HRBP Framework, establishing a common language and set of expectations for the full learning experience. Participants complete a personalized HRBP assessment that highlights individual strengths and development opportunities.

This kickoff session helps participants understand how the framework applies to their role and how assessment insights can be used to focus development throughout the certificate. By grounding the cohort in a shared strategic lens, the session ensures consistent framing as participants engage in research, peer exchange, and applied learning across the program.

Key Takeaways

  • Understand the CAHRS HRBP Framework and what defines effective HRBP practice
  • Gain insight into personal strengths and development opportunities through a personalized assessment
  • Learn how to use assessment insights to focus development across the program
  • Establish a shared language and framing for HRBP work throughout the certificate
